Getting Caught Driving without a CDL..What happens
Kefid · If the vehicles are required to be operated by a CDL driver, then there can be some heavy penalties if they are caught. Driving without a CDL, or suspended CDL, incurs a civil penalty of up to $2,500 or, in aggravated cases, criminal penalties of up to $5,000 in fines and/or up to 90 days in prison.

What Is The Biggest Truck You Can Drive Without A CDL?
Generally, you can drive up to a 26,000 GVW truck and pull up to a 10,000 GVW trailer behind it and not require a CDL. In most states, yes, you can pull a trailer heavier than 10,000 GVW without a CDL, so long as the combined GVWs of the truck and trailer aren't greater than 26,000.
